An Interview With Shaitan 

published by Dabistan E Zehra, Bombay, India. 



Once our beloved Prophet Mohammed (may the peace of Allah be upon him 
and his Progeny) was walking out with his As'haabs (companions) from the 
back side of the J an'atul Baqi (Medina). As he was stepping out, he saw a 
very old man with a colourful hat on his head, colourful belt with diamonds 
on it was around his waist, with a bell in his left hand, and with a net in his 
right hand. This old man said 'As salamu alaikum yah Rasool Allah' (O 
Prophet of Allah may the peace of Allah be upon you) to our beloved 
Prophet. Prophet didn't reply to his salaam. This old man knew why our 
Prophet didn't reply to his salaam. After all this old man was not like any 
other old man, he was Shaitan-the cursed one. Then Shaitan said, 'Salaam 
ul-llahai Alaykum yah Rasool Allah' (Allah's peace be upon you O Prophet of 
Allah). Then, our Prophet accepted his salaam. Now, the As'haabs 
(companions) of Prophet understood that this was the cursed one Shaitan. 



All the As'haabs were surprised to see the cursed one personally. Shaitan 
(the cursed one) attempted to misguide even the Prophets and Imams. 
Shaitan-the cursed one used to meet with prophets to answer any questions 
of the Prophets. In fact, it was obligatory on him (the cursed Shaitan) to 
answer the questions of the Messengers of Allah. 

Our beloved Prophet, though he had all the Knowledge, only for the sake of 
his companions, asked Shaitan-the cursed one the following questions: 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

O Shaitan, people are interested in your hat, tell me what is this hat? 
Shaitan-the cursed one : 

Shaitan the cursed one replied, o Prophet of Allah, my colourful hat is this 
materialistic worldly goods, perishable worldly benefits, and temporary 
worldly enjoyment. Once, any person get caught by this colourful hat of 
mine, then that person stays in my control and forgets all about the 
hereafter.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, what is this belt you are wearing with gold and diamonds around 

your waist? 

Shaitan-the cursed one: 

O Prophet, this is my second weapon which keeps my back bone strong. O 

Prophet, those Momneens (believers) who do not get into my trap by my 

hat, I use this weapon.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

But what is it? 

Shaitan the cursed one : 



O Prophet this are the worldly behijaabs (un-veiled) woman/girl of this 
worlds. Through this behijaab (un-veiled) woman/girls I deceive the 
momineens (believers). 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

But what is this bell you are holding in your left hand ? 
Shaitan the cursed one : 

This is the bell through which I destroy the imaan (faith) of the believers.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

How do you do that ? 
Shaitan the cursed one : 

Whenever I see believers arguing with each other, getting into minor verbal 
antagonism or disagreement with each other, then I ring this bell. As I ring 
this bell, these believers get into major verbal fights and thy start saying 
things (such as backbiting, false accusations or uses bad language) to each 
other due to which there own imaan (faith) disappears from hearts.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

But what is this net you are holding? 
Shaitan the cursed one : 

When I see the believers not getting trap by any form of my weapons then I 
throw this net at them as my last weapon.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

But what is this net ?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

O Prophet of Allah, this is Riyah Kari (performing good deeds only to show 



people). Whenever, I see that a believer is performing all the good deeds 
and that person not getting caught by my weapon, then i throw this net at 
them. By stepping at this net, their good deeds which they were performing 
for Allah, becomes invalid. Because the believers gradually get ego in them 
while performing all their prayers, observing fast, performing Hajj, paying 
Zakat and Khums, and several other duties towards Allah. They (believers) 
perform all these and other good deeds, but after they get caught by my 
net, they show their good deeds to other and as though they have done 
favour on Allah by performing such good deeds. They tell people when they 
perform night prayers, they tell people when they fast, they tell people when 
they go to Hajj. They give money in charity but only to show off or for their 
personal interest. This is how they eventually feel superior to those people 
whom they know are not performing these good deeds. All these actions 
which take place after they step on my net makes their good deed go waste 
(void). 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, tell me one more thing, now that you have spent so much of your 
time in this life with your bad deeds, do you have any friend, Do you have 
companion? 

Shaitan-the cursed one: 

Although, I visit all the houses and all the people in general, but I have 11 
(eleven) types of people, that are my best friends and companions. And I 
have 15 (fifteen) types of people that I hate them the most. O Prophet, keep 
in mind that a person who is my friend is an enemy of Allah, and a person 
who is my enemy is a friend of Allah. 



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

shaitan tell me who are your friends and who are your enemies? 

(Then, Shaitan told our beloved Prophet a list of his friends and a list of his 

enemies. After he described his enemies our beloved Prophet asked his 

reasons. We have excluded the question of our beloved Prophet and simply 

listed the name or description of the enemy followed by his reason in some 

cases.) 

Shaitan-the cursed one: 

Shaitan said, O Prophet of Allah, first I have 15 (fifteen) enemies, and these 

are as follows: 

ENEMIES OF SHAITAN (THE CURSED ONE) 

1. O Prophet of Allah, my first enemy is you and your Ahlul-Bait (progeny) 
because if it wasn't for you and your AhlulBait, my mission would be quite 
successful. There would have been not even a single believer (follower of 
right path shown by Allah). You bought the religion of Allah (al-lslam) to this 
world, You made people believers of Allah's communication. 

2. O Prophet of Allah my second enemy is that just ruler who rules a nation 
with complete justice. 

3. O Prophet of Allah, my third enemy is that rich person who does not have 
any ego or feel superior to other poor people around him. 

4. O Prophet of Allah, my fourth enemy is that business man who perform his 
business with justice. 

5. O Prophet of Allah my fifth enemy is that Aalim (scholar) who fears Allah 
and practice what he preaches. 

6. O Prophet of Allah, my sixth enemy is that specific Mo'min (believer) who 



work on showing other the path of truth. Who offer other the knowledge of 
Wajibats (obligatory) and Haram (forbidden) duties of Allah. This person is 
undoing all my hard work. 

7. O Prophet of Allah, my seventh enemy is that person who does not listen to 
what is forbidden, does not see what is forbidden, and does not eat what is 
forbidden. 

Comment by Maulana Sadiq Hasan Qibla: This person does not look any Na- 
Mehram women/men (a women with whom a man can marry or a man with 
whom a woman can marry), does not watches movies or shows. This person 
prevent himself or herself from listening to Music, Songs, lies, or Geebath 
(Backbiting). This person does not eat forbidden food (meat which is not cut 
according to the Islamic ways such as meat cut by non Muslim business 
men, etc.) and that food which is not purchased with the halal (allowed) 
earnings (such as earnings from selling alcohol, from gambling, from selling 
drugs and from many other sources which are forbidden in Islam.) 

8. O Prophet of Allah, my eighth enemy is that believer who keeps himself 
clean all the time. A person who stays in Wuzu and who wears clean clothes. 

9. O Prophet of Allah, my ninth enemy is that person who has a big heart. Who 
spents his/her money for the sake of Allah. 

Comment by Maulana Sadiq Hasan: Once Prophet of Allah asked his 
companion did you know that one Dinar can be more than One Lakh 
(hundred thousand) Dinar? Prophet's companions replied no O Prophet of 
Allah. Then, (our beloved) Prophet of Allah said, "If a person who owns for 
instance ten lakhs and gives one lakh in charity is less than that poor man 
who owns two dinnar and gives one dinnar in charity." 
10. O Prophet of Allah, my tenth enemy is that person who gives Sadqa 



(charity) only for the name of Allah. 

11. o Prophet of Allah, my eleventh enemy is that person who reads, 
memorizes, and act according to Quran. 

12. O Prophet of Allah, my twelfth enemy is that person who recites "Namaz-e- 
Shab" (prayers recited after the midnight and before namaz Fajr). I am 
always afraid of this person. 

13. O Prophet of Allah, my thirteenth enemy is that person who offers his wajib 
(obligatory) Khums, wajib Zakat, and other wajib sadaqas. 

14. O Prophet of Allah, my fourteenth enemy is that woman who observes 
Hijaab (Veil) and safeguards her Hijaab. 

15. O Prophet of Allah, my fifteenth enemy is that who performs his 
"Ibadat" (such as prayers) without having thoughts except for the thoughts 
of Allah. 

After hearing the list of fifteen enemies of Shaitan, our beloved Prophet of 
Allah (may the peace of Allah be upon him and his progeny) asked Shaitan 
to name his eleven friends. Upon which, the cursed Shaitan named the 
following eleven people: 

THE FRIENDS OF SHAITAN (THE CURSED ONE) 

1. The first friend of mine is that leader who is a oppressor (Zalim). 

2. My second friend is that business man who does his/ her business by 
deceiving his / her customers. 

3. My third friend is that "Mo'min" (believer) who drinks alcohol. 

4. My fourth friend is that rich person who is proud of his wealth and who 
angrily refuses to give money in charity to poor and needy. 



5. My fifth friend is that person who does backbiting (Geebat), who talks 
to people in such a way that enemity increases between people and 
who reveals the defects of people. 

6. My sixth friend is that person who kill other human being for any 
reason other than for Allah. 

7. My seventh friend is that person who snatches away the belongings 
(such as wealth) of an orphan. 

8. My eighth friend is that person whose livelihood is based on collecting 
interest. 

9. My ninth friend is that person who gives more important to his worldly 
life rather than giving important to his life after death. This friend of 
mine prefers to performs those deeds which he know, will bring 
benefits in this world but in hereafter such deeds will bring loss. 

10. My tenth friend is that person who keep long hopes and delays in 
asking for forgiveness from Allah. 

(Here Maulana gave the example of that person who delays in asking 
forgiveness from Allah. For instance he said, "people refuse to ask 
forgiveness from Allah because they say we are young and angel of 
death is not running after us yet. Therefore these people, who delay in 
asking for repentance, say we are not going to quit listening to music, 
we are not going to observe Hijab, or we are not going to keep the 
beard. These people say that they will do all this after ten or more 
years. These are the tenth friends of Shaitan, because they keep long 
hopes and delay in asking for forgiveness from Allah.") 

11. My eleventh friend is that person who helps women to increase their 
interest in performing "Jaadu" (magic) on people. 



After naming his eleven friends Shaitan-the cursed one said, "these are my 

eleven friends who are the worst enemies of Allah". 

Now the interview of shaitan (the cursed one) was continued by Prophet 

Mohammed (may the peace of Allah be upon him and his progeny) as 

follows: 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, tell us why you stop my followers from offering their prayers? What 
benefits you get out of it?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

Whenever your follower recites prayers, my body gets feverish and it starts 
to shiver, and with a sick body I can't deceive your followers from obeying 
Allah.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Why do you stop my followers from observing fast (roza) during the month 
of Ramadhan?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

When they fast they put me in prison, and I can't deceive them during the 
time they fast because I end up in prison and I can't misguide them.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

When my flowers prepare to fight in Allah's way, why do you stop them?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

When they go to fight for Allah's sake, my hands get tight to my neck, and I 
can't deceive them by having my hands tight to my neck.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 



Why do you prevent my followers from performing Hajj?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

When they go for Hajj, their movements of going towards Hajj ties my legs. 
And with legs tied, I cannot misguide your followers from obeying Allans 
commands.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

why do you prevent my followers from reciting Holy Quran?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

When they recite the Holy Quran, my existence turns into nonexistence. 
And, without having my existence, how can I deceive your followers from 
living according to the will of Allah.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Why do you prevent my followers from offering "Doa" (praying to Allah)?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

When they recite Doa (such as Doa-e-Komail) I get deaf and dum. How can 
I deceive your followers without having the ability to speak and ability to 
listen. o prophet of Allah (s.a.w.) from living the life according to the will of 
Allah.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, tell me why you prevent my followers from paying Sadaqha?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

O Prophet of Allah (s.a.w.), when your follower pay Sadaqha (giving money 
in charity), it is as that they cut me with a saw in two pieces and throw one 
pieces of mine in east and other piece in the west. 



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Why do you get such a strong blow when my followers pay Sadaqha? Why 
do you get cut into two pieces?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

Whenever a person gives his / her money in charity, that person receives 
three benefits from Allah. The first benefit such person receive is that Allah 
becomes his / her borrowers. The second benefit such person gets is that 
Allah makes Heaven in his / her inheritance (such that he / she will be called 
as an owner of heaven). And, the third benefit he / she receives is that such 
person gets 700 times increase in his / her wealth from Allah, which in turn 
this person uses his / her increased wealth for charity.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, now tell me when does a person (who is my follower) gets under 
your total control?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

O Prophet of Allah, your followers gets under my total (absolute) control 
when they perform three things The first thing is that when your followers 
becomes stingy ("kanjoos") he gets under my total control. Stingy is the 
root of all the sins which takes a person towards performing all types of 
other sins. The second thing is that when a person gradually start forgiving 
his / her sins. A person who perform such deeds which are against the will of 
Allah and then after performing such deeds that person does remember it 
and does not ask for any forgiveness, then that person gets under my 
absolute control. O Prophet of Allah, any person who performs these three 
deeds then that person gets under my absolute control. 



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, you know that Allah gave my followers a strong weapon of 

forgiveness. Whenever, my followers, ask for true forgiveness with an 

intention of not repeating that sin, Allah forgives them. How do you deal 

with this problem? 

Shaitan-the cursed one: 

I know O Prophet of Allah, Allah has given them this strong weapon, but I 

have prepared myself to confront your followers with their strong weapon.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

What method do you have through which you prevent my followers from 
asking for forgiveness?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

O Prophet of Allah, to deal with this problem I have created four different 
units. Each unit deals with a different age groups of your followers. I n each 
unit group I make your followers perform such deeds which make the 
repentance of your followers invalid (void). 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

What are these units?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

The first unit is that I involve your old men indulging in four sins. I make 
them lie, I make them accuse someone of something which they have not 
done, I make them testify falsely, and I make them perfrom without having 
the complete knowledge of the laws of performing prayers. O Prophet of 
Allah (s.a.w.) your old men will be offering doas, offering prayers, and 
reciting obligatory prayers, but if you talk to them you will hear them talking 



bad about other people, testing the bad deeds of other people without being 
their witness, and reciting obligatory prayers without knowing all the laws of 
the prayers. Your old men will not try to learn the laws of prayers because of 
their ego. Whenever some young men from your Ummat, try to explain the 
right way of performing Wuzu, your old men will say that you have just 
entered Islam and now you are trying to teach as how to perform Wuzu. 
O Prophet of Allah, my second unit is that which takes care of your young 
man from your Ummath. I do not prevent your young man from reciting 
prayers, performing Hajj, or doing anything else except that I get them 
involved in two things. First thing I make them do is that they look at things 
which are forbidden for them, and they will listen to those things which are 
forbidden for them. (Here, by things these young men will look at which are 
forbidden are girls, and things that these young men will listen to is music/ 
songs.) 

O Prophet of Allah, my third unit is that which deceives your old ladies. I 
make your old ladies perform Geebath (backbiting), falsely accuse other 
people, destroy the character of other men and women, and get interested 
in doing magic on other men and women. 

O Prophet of Allah, my fourth unit is not active, because it is suppose to take 
care of young girls of Ummath. Since all of your girls are already my soldiers 
and I have a strong hold over them, I do not get any hard time deceiving 
them. However, one in one thousand, I find such girl which I see her may be 
following your way of life, and I will not be able to do anything to deceive 
her.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, tell me do you get upset when you see any of your soldier get out 



of your hand and follow Allah's commands?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

No, O Prophet of Allah, I don't get upset. I wait till that person performs any 
good deed, and then I go to that person again and deceive him / her so that 
he / she feels that he did a favour to Allah by performing such a good deed.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

You make that person feel that he did favour to Allah?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

Yes, O Prophet of Allah, that person goes around after performing a good 
deed and tells people what he did, such as that I recited namaz, I observed 
fast, I paid so much money to that person, or I helped that person in his bad 
times. 

Our beloved Prophet (s.a.w.) : 

Shaitan, how do you deceive those followers of mine who try their best not 
to get deceived by you? 
Shaitan-the cursed one: 

Allah made one deed which if your followers performed it with right intention 
and at right time they can never get deceived by me. And that deed is 
Namaz (Salat/obligatory prayers). But, to solve this problem, what I did is 
that with every one of your followers I have assigned one of my soldier 
whose name is "Mutawaqee". And, his job is to make your follower lazy and 
involved in such activities due to which your follower recites namaz at the 
last time. When your follower recites namaz (salat) in last minute, he / she 
recites it in such a way that his namaz is not acceptable to Allah.
